Lakota, Gold Fields strike deal

South African mining house Gold Fields (GFI-N) has taken an option on the land package recently consolidated by Lakota Resources (YLA-V) in the Lake Victoria gold district of Tanzania.Under the terms …


AngloGold eyes top spot with Ashanti takeover

Looking to regain top spot among global gold producers, South Africa’s AngloGold (AU-N) has entered talks aimed at achieving a merger with Ghana-based Ashanti Goldfields (ASL-N).The talks are centred …


North American Palladium coasts on stronger loony

The weaker U.S. dollar has enabled North American Palladium (PDL-T) to overcome substantial increases in operating expenses and income taxes.Net earnings topped $8.4 million (or 17 per share) on $41….

BC promotes mineral investment

The government of British Columbia will spend $1.2 million over two years to fund a geoscience program designed to stimulate mineral exploration.The Rocks to Riches program will be managed by the Brit…



Iamgold earnings bolstered by acquisitions

First-quarter earnings at Iamgold (IMG-T) rose year-over-year in 2003, partly as a result of higher gold prices and partly because production from the Tarkwa and Damang mines in Ghana is now part of I…
